What is a Numerology Calculator for Address?

A numerology calculator for address is a specialized tool designed to determine the unique energetic vibration associated with a specific physical address. Just as individuals have a birth chart or life path number, every location—be it a home, office, or business—possesses its own numerical signature. This signature, derived from the letters and numbers within the address, is believed to influence the experiences, opportunities, and challenges faced by those who reside or work there.

This calculator performs a semantic analysis of your address, converting each character into its corresponding numerological value and then reducing the sum to a single digit (1-9) or a powerful Master Number (11, 22, 33). The resulting number provides insights into the prevailing energy and purpose of the space.

Numerology Calculator for Address Formula and Explanation

The core of any numerology calculator for address lies in its method of converting letters and numbers into a single, meaningful digit. The most widely accepted method for addresses in the Western world is the Pythagorean system. Here's a breakdown of the formula and its variables:

The Pythagorean System Mapping:

Each letter of the alphabet is assigned a numerical value from 1 to 9, and all digits in the address are summed directly.

Numbers (0-9) within the address are added at their face value.

The Calculation Steps:

  1. Character Extraction: The calculator first processes the entire address string, separating letters and numbers. Punctuation, spaces, and special characters are typically ignored as they do not carry numerological weight.
  2. Value Assignment: Each letter is converted to its corresponding Pythagorean numerical value. Each digit (0-9) is added as its face value.
  3. Initial Summation: All assigned numerical values (from both letters and numbers) are added together to form a total initial sum.
  4. Reduction to a Single Digit or Master Number: The total sum is then reduced by repeatedly summing its digits until a single digit (1-9) is reached. However, if the sum at any point becomes 11, 22, or 33 (before reducing further), these are considered "Master Numbers" and are not reduced.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Address Numerology

Q1: Do I include street suffixes like "Street," "Avenue," "Road," or "Lane" in the calculation?

A: Yes, for a complete and accurate numerological reading, you should include all parts of your address, including suffixes like Street, Ave, Rd, Ln, etc. Each letter contributes to the overall vibration.

Q2: What about apartment, suite, or unit numbers (e.g., Apt 3, #5, Suite 2B)?

A: Absolutely. These are crucial for multi-unit dwellings. Include the full apartment/suite/unit designation (e.g., "Apt 3," "Suite 2B," "#5") as they provide the specific energetic layer for your individual space within a larger building.

Q3: What if my address has letters in the number, like "123B Main Street"?

A: Treat the letter 'B' just like any other letter in the address. It will be assigned its corresponding numerological value (B=2 in Pythagorean) and added to the total sum along with the numbers 1, 2, and 3.

Q4: What is a Master Number in address numerology?

A: Master Numbers are 11, 22, and 33. If your address sum reduces to one of these, it signifies a powerful, intensified vibration. They suggest higher potential for inspiration, achievement, or spiritual teaching, but often come with increased responsibility and challenges.

Q8: What's the difference between Pythagorean and Chaldean numerology for addresses?

A: The main difference lies in the letter-to-number mapping. The Pythagorean system uses a 1-9 cycle for letters (A=1, B=2...I=9, J=1, etc.). The Chaldean system uses values 1-8 for letters but does not include 9, and its assignments are different (A=1, B=2, C=3, D=4, E=5, F=8, G=3, H=5, I=1, J=1, K=2, L=3, M=4, N=5, O=7, P=8, Q=8, R=2, S=3, T=4, U=6, V=6, W=6, X=5, Y=1, Z=7). Pythagorean is generally considered more straightforward and is widely applied to addresses.
